Skeng to headline debut show in Costa Rica with Ding Dong
The Latin American market has emerged as a growing hotspot for dancehall, with consistent demand for performances by Jamaican stars. Skeng and Ding Dong are slated to perform on May 31 in San José, Costa Rica, at the birthday celebration of New York-based Costa Rican promoter Eddie O.
Skeng, continuing to expand his international reach, will be making his Costa Rica debut, while veteran deejay Ding Dong, fresh off the release of his debut album, is known worldwide for his electrifying dancehall performances.
The event will be hosted by Shenseea's manager, Dizzy Cleanface, who also shares Costa Rican roots, under his We Good brand, alongside Marcus Platinum Kids from New York.
Over the years, Costa Rica has developed a strong connection to dancehall, with the genre flourishing alongside reggaeton in the streets. Artists like Shenseea, Skillibeng, and Teejay—alongside veterans such as Beenie Man and Charly Black—have all delivered well-received performances in the country.
Dancehall heavyweight Aidonia is set to bring his 20th anniversary celebration to Costa Rica this October, following successful shows in New York and Jamaica. Meanwhile, dancehall superstar Vybz Kartel is also expected to perform in the country soon, with a new date to be announced following a previously postponed show.
